Kanye West vows to help Taylor Swift get her 'masters back' from record executive Scooter Braun, as he promises to bring change to the music industry in latest bizarre Twitter rant

Kanye West continued his attack on the music industry on Friday, this time vowing to help fellow artist Taylor Swift get ownership of her masters, amid his own ongoing legal battle to obtain rights to his music.

The 43-year-old rapper shared a series of tweets on Friday afternoon, promising to bring change to the structure of the music industry and record labels, which he has criticized for taking ownership of artists' work, including his own.  

Kanye told followers he would 'personally' ensure former nemesis and now friend Taylor Swift 'gets her masters back' from record label executive Scooter Braun, suggesting he would take the issue up with Braun himself.

'I'M GOING TO PERSONALLY SEE TO IT THAT TAYLOR SWIFT GETS HER MASTERS BACK. SCOOTER IS A CLOSE FAMILY FRIEND,' he tweeted.

'WE'RE GOING TO MOVE THE ENTIRE MUSIC INDUSTRY INTO THE 21ST CENTURY.'

Swift, 30, became embroiled in a feud with former record label boss Scott Borchetta last year after he sold Big Machine records to Braun, giving him ownership of all music recorded under the label. 

Neither Swift nor Braun have commented publicly on Kanye's offer.  

The rapper also went on to take a jab at Drake, saying he will help bring change to every album, publishing, merchandise, and touring deal for all artists but him.   

'JUST KIDDING ... I LOVE DRAKE TOO ... ALL ARTIST MUST BE FREE,' West tweeted. 

Kanye first launched his attack on the music industry and his fight for his masters earlier this week.     

That Twitter storm on Wednesday, during which shared a video of himself urinating on one of his Grammy Awards, resulted in his account being suspended for 24 hours.

Kanye first acknowledged his bipolar disorder in 2018, a condition that is associated with episodes of mood swings ranging from depressive lows to manic highs and can be controlled with medication.
